摘要:本文面向tpwallet内测版,围绕实时支付分析、领先科技趋势、专家见地、交易明细、实时数据监测与安全验证进行系统剖析,给出可操作的设计要点、监控指标与风险缓解建议。
1. 实时支付分析
- 目标与指标:定义SLO(授权成功率≥99.5%、p95端到端授权延迟≤200ms、TPS弹性支持峰值5k/s、结算延迟<24小时)。关键指标包括TPS、p50/p95/p99延迟、错误率、拒付率、幂等冲突率与对账差异。
- 流程要点:客户端→网关→风险评估→发卡行/第三方支付→授权→回执。每步记录唯一transaction_id、idempotency_key、状态机(pending→authorized→captured→settled→reversed)与事件时间戳,保证可追溯性与幂等性。
2. 领先科技趋势
- 流式架构:采用Kafka/Pulsar + Flink/ksql 实时处理交易事件、计算实时聚合与特征。CDC用于对账与账本同步。

- 边缘/移动侧能力:本地化风控特征预评估、离线队列与连接恢复策略;采用gRPC/WebSocket实现低延迟通知。
- ML与自适应规则:线上流式模型做实时风险评分(评分每笔返回并作为决策输入),模型在线A/B与漂移检测。
3. 专家见地剖析
- 可观测性优先:每个请求必须携带trace_id,链路追踪(Jaeger/Zipkin)、metrics(Prometheus)与日志(ELK)三位一体,便于快速定位延迟与异常点。
- 聚焦可解释性:风险模型需输出可解释特征与置信度,保障人工复核效率并降低误杀。
4. 交易明细设计(示例字段)
- 必有字段:transaction_id, user_id, amount, currency, merchant_id, timestamp, status, payment_method, idempotency_key, risk_score, auth_code, acquirer_response。
- 衍生字段:geo_ip, device_fingerprint, channel_latency_ms, reconciliation_tag,便于分析和审计。
5. 实时数据监测体系
- 实时仪表盘:交易量、延迟分布、失败原因占比、异常交易样本与地域分布。
- 异常检测与告警:基于统计与ML的双层策略(阈值告警+模型检测);对关键指标设置自动抑制与告警分级(P0-P3)。
- 自动化补救:短路器、回退到次优支付路径、延迟队列重试与人工干预流水线。

6. 安全验证与合规
- 传输与存储:TLS 1.3、端到端加密、卡数据使用令牌化与分离式账本,敏感数据落入HSM/云KMS管理。遵循PCI DSS与当地监管要求。
- 身份与设备验证:强制多因素认证、设备指纹、证书绑定、应用完整性检测(签名与防篡改)与远程证明(attestation)。
- 平台防护:节流、行为分析、IP信誉、交易速率限制与实时风控引擎;定期渗透测试、代码审计与红队演练。
7. 风险点与建议
- 延迟带来的风控误判:建立延迟容错规则,关键场景允许异步补偿并标记风险感知窗口。
- 数据漂移与模型失效:实施模型监控(性能与特征分布),并建立自动回滚与人工审查通道。
- 对账与资金一致性:双写不可接受,采用事件溯源与幂等设计、定时批对账与异常自动拉审。
结论:tpwallet内测版应以低延迟、高可观测性与多层安全为核心,把实时流式处理、在线风控与严格的安全验证结合起来。通过明确SLO、结构化交易明细、完善的监控与自动化补救机制,可以在内测阶段迅速发现问题并稳步演进到公测与生产。
评论
Alice
文章很实用,特别是关于流式架构和实时监控的部分,帮我梳理了内测优先级。
玄远
建议在模型监控中补充特征重要性漂移可视化,这样便于快速定位问题来源。
TechGuru
对安全验证的建议全面,尤其是HSM与attestation部分,落地性强。
小赵
交易明细示例很棒,已借鉴字段设计用于我们项目的对账模块。